Adopt South West has achieved a prestigious status for its work in finding caring families for children in the region.
The regional adoption agency has gained recognition for the high standards of its fostering for adoption, earning the “Early Permanence Quality Mark Award”.

A service of remembrance for families, couples and individuals affected by the loss of a baby, whether that be during pregnancy, at birth or in infancy is to be held on Saturday the 18th November at 11.00am at St Andrew’s Minster in Plymouth. In addition, anyone grieving never having children is also most welcome to attend.
